Brooklands lagoon

We walked from Spencer Park to the Waimakariri River mouth via the walkway through the dunes and back along the beach.  Since the earthquake the track that used to run along beside the lagoon has in many places been moved up into the dunes.  This is because the water level has risen substantially, and much of the old track is now flooded.  There are usually birds on the beach, but not much visible on the lagoon from this track, just a few shags and black swans.  We saw black-backed and red billed gulls, white fronted terns, oyster catchers and banded dotterels along the beach.
